Output deafb23f011c0f2701f565ac80b024c6c4f7ca58c0e3ead557f20829df161e8e:0

value
3436115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24142352beb1961493ba245fae4aa068e4b8629d OP_EQUAL
address
34ynNfJGVv6s7aNKyXJhRkifqXmasuXfNz
transaction
deafb23f011c0f2701f565ac80b024c6c4f7ca58c0e3ead557f20829df161e8e
spent
true